PTOC Assistant Professor of Accounting Apply now Job no: 559767 Work type: Instructional Faculty – Tenured/Tenure-Track Location: Stanislaus - Turlock Categories: Unit 3 - CFA - California Faculty Association, Tenured/Tenure-Track, Full Time, Faculty - Business/Management Faculty Employment Opportunity POSITION: ASSISTANT PROFESSOR OF ACCOUNTING: The Department of Accounting & Finance invites applications

for a full-time, tenure-track appointment in Accounting at the rank of Assistant Professor, beginning August 2027. Responsibilities for the person appointed to this position will include: Effective teaching and mentoring of students as they progress through their academic career. Teaching responsibilities for this position will be fulfilled primarily at our Turlock campus. A record of scholarship that will meet AACSB

Scholarly Academic standards. Service to the Department of Accounting and Finance, the College of Business Administration, and the University. This is an academic year appointment. However, opportunities may exist for an additional Summer Session appointment. This position is contingent upon the availability of authorized funding. MINIMUM QUALIFICATIONS: Candidates must possess a doctoral degree in Business

Administration with an emphasis in Accounting or a related field from an AACSB-accredited doctoral institution at the time of appointment. PREFERRED QUALIFICATIONS: We welcome candidates with the ability and experience to teach a variety of accounting courses, especially in Accounting Information Systems and Data Analytics. An interest in emerging areas such as Artificial Intelligence and Intermediate Accounting

would be a valuable addition to our program. Professional certifications and/or relevant industry experience are highly regarded. We seek candidates committed to conducting meaningful research, with demonstrated potential to publish in respected, peer-reviewed accounting journals. A potential candidate's consideration will be enhanced with evidence of (or potential for) successful and innovative teaching experiences

at the undergraduate level, and a commitment to support a diverse student body with a variety of ethnic, cultural, and socioeconomic backgrounds.
